The modular MOVI-C® automation system provides a common platform for control cabinet controllers and decentralized controllers with the same functionalities and the same variety of interfaces.
The controllers from the MOVI-C® automation modular system can be used for a wide range of motion control or automation tasks and are connected to the higher-level controller of a machine cell or system via fieldbus slave interfaces for the PROFINET, EtherNet/IPTM or Modbus TCP fieldbus systems. As an EtherCAT®/SBusPLUS master, the controller ensures smooth communication with subordinate units, such as MOVIDRIVE® or MOVIGEAR® performance, and their clock-synchronous connection to the motion/application.
However, the integrated software of the centralized and decentralized controllers offers the decisive added value for reducing complexity: parameterization instead of programming. For you as a user, this software means more scope for parameterization and less programming effort.
The simple central data storage and the auto-reload function for exchange are further advantages of our control technology, thus keeping the reliability and availability of automation technology in your production constantly at a very high level.

Technical data
MOVI-C® CONTROLLER power performance class
Control of 32/32 axes
- PROFINET slave, Ethernet/IPTM slave, Modbus TCP/IP slave
- 7× USB 2.0
- 2 GB CFast memory card
- ≤ 32 interpolating axes
- ≤ 32 auxiliary axes
- A second operating system, Windows embedded 7, can be optionally connected via state-of-the-art Hypervisor technology, e.g. for integrated visualization
- PC based
MOVI-C® CONTROLLER progressive performance class
Control of 16/16 axes
- PROFINET slave, Ethernet/IPTM slave, Modbus TCP/IP slave
- 2 GB CFast memory card
- ≤ 16 interpolating axes
- ≤ 16 auxiliary axes
- PC based
MOVI-C® CONTROLLER advanced performance class
- 2x CAN, 1 of which is electrically isolated
- 1x RS485
- PROFINET slave, Ethernet/IPTM slave, Modbus TCP/IP slave
- Status display for PLC and fieldbus
- Optional: Installation in a master module, can be added to MOVIDRIVE® modular
- SD memory card
- ≤ 8 interpolating axes
- ≤ 8 auxiliary axes
MOVIC® CONTROLLER standard performance class
- 1x CAN, non-isolated
- PROFINET slave, Ethernet/IPTM slave, Modbus TCP/IP slave
- Status display for PLC and fieldbus
- SD memory card
- ≤ 2 interpolated axes
- ≤ 6 auxiliary axes

Startup with MOVIRUN® software platform
MOVIRUN® flexible – the flexible and open platform:
- Automation with MOVI-C® and third-party components
- Interpolated operating modes for demanding motion control applications
- Modern programming system (IEC 61131)
- Ready-to-use software modules from the MOVIKIT® modular software system can be integrated into the user program
Operation with MOVIKIT® software modules
For simple drive functions up to demanding motion control functions
- Graphical configuration and diagnostics
- Available for MOVIDRIVE® technology and MOVIRUN® flexible for integration into the IEC program with user-friendly IEC interface
Modules:
- MOVIKIT® Velocity, Positioning
- MOVIKIT® MultiMotion, MultiMotion Camming
- MOVIKIT® MultiAxisController
- MOVIKIT® Robotics
- and many more
